Before archiving a cold storage bucket in Glacierette, detach all plugin hooks. Run the freeze job, confirm checksum parity, then revoke scoped tokens. Do not delete manifests; the Vexhall recovery service reads them during account restoration. If the bucket owner's account is locked, trigger the recovery flow from the Opsgate console, not the plugin API. Archival completes within 20 minutes. Plugins must tolerate 404s on frozen objects. To unseal the restore job, use the passphrase below.

vault phrase of fawig-yagug = tamix-norys-ulaix-joreth-druius-jorael-briax-prair-lamael-caseth-brivan-lamius-istius

Subject: Customer concentration at Veldane Group

Team,

Our latest review shows Torbray Logistics now accounts for 34% of branch revenue across the Halwick region. This level of dependency exposes us to renewal risk and pricing pressure. Branch managers should begin mapping secondary accounts with growth potential before the Q3 planning cycle. The next steps are outlined in the note below.

management briefing: Project Ulavan slips by two quarters because of the staffing delay.

Severity: High. Since the 14:20 deploy, the role-based access service rejects signed role manifests from the wiki's permission exporter with "signature mismatch." Editors are silently downgraded to viewers, so pages appear read-only. I've confirmed the manifest payload is well-formed and the clock skew is under two seconds, which rules out the usual suspects. I suspect the exporter is still signing with the pre-rotation key. For verification, the currently trusted key is the one below.

release key, hadug-kawef: bky13_mPGeFZeR1GZ1G

## Formula sandbox tuning

User-supplied formulas in Gridmoor execute inside a restricted interpreter with hard ceilings on time, memory, and call depth. Reviewers should confirm any change to these ceilings is justified in the PR description, since raising them widens the abuse surface. Defaults were chosen from production traces. The current limits are as follows.

limits module of tafog-fawip:
WEIGHTS = {
    "julix": 57,
    "lamys": 992,
    "kasvan": 209,
    "quenok": 750,
    "alddor": 259,
    "oliath": 1009,
    "wenix": 815,
}